How to Choose the Best Olive Oil for Air Fryer
When picking the best olive oil for your air fryer, not all oils are created equal. The right choice can enhance flavor, prevent sticking, and withstand high heat without breaking down. Here are the key features to consider to make the best decision.
Smoke Point
Look for an olive oil with a high smoke point—ideally 400°F or higher. When oil smokes, it degrades, loses nutritional value, and can create harmful compounds. Oils like Mantova Air Fryer Spray (up to 450°F) and Graza Sizzle are designed to handle air fryer temperatures, making them safer and more effective for crisp, even cooking.
Form: Spray vs. Liquid
Spray oils are often more convenient for air fryers. They distribute a fine, even layer, reducing excess oil and preventing soggy food. Sprays like Graza Sizzle Olive Oil Spray and Pompeian Organic Robust EVOO Spray offer propellant-free options that are healthier and cleaner. If using liquid oil, apply sparingly with a brush or bottle to avoid buildup.
Flavor Profile
A mellow or neutral flavor works best for most air fryer dishes so it doesn’t overpower your food. Graza Sizzle and Pompeian Smooth EVOO offer mild tastes ideal for roasting vegetables, proteins, or even baking. If you prefer bold flavor, use robust oils like Atlas Organic Moroccan EVOO just before serving or for finishing.
Oil Quality and Purity
Choose extra virgin olive oil (EVOO) that’s cold-pressed, organic, and free from additives. These oils retain more antioxidants and polyphenols, which are good for heart health. Products like Atlas Organic Moroccan EVOO and Pompeian Organic Robust EVOO are USDA Organic and third-party certified, ensuring authenticity and quality.
Packaging Size and Value
For frequent use, a bulk option like Pompeian Smooth EVOO 3L offers long-term savings. For occasional spritzing, a compact spray can like PAM or Graza is more practical and prevents waste.

FAQs
What is the best olive oil for air fryer use?
The best olive oil for air fryer use is one with a high smoke point (400°F or higher), like Graza Sizzle Olive Oil Spray or Mantova Air Fryer Spray, which prevent smoking and maintain flavor. Opt for propellant-free, cold-pressed extra virgin olive oil for healthier, cleaner cooking.
Can I use extra virgin olive oil in my air fryer?
Yes, you can use extra virgin olive oil in your air fryer, but choose a high smoke point variety or use it at lower temperatures. For best results, apply sparingly or opt for EVOO specifically formulated for high-heat cooking like Graza Sizzle or Pompeian Organic Robust EVOO Spray.
Why use olive oil spray in an air fryer?
Olive oil spray ensures an even, light coating that promotes crispiness without sogginess, making it ideal for air fryers. Sprays like Graza Sizzle and Pompeian Organic Robust EVOO Spray offer no-propellant formulas that are healthier and prevent oil buildup.
Is it safe to spray olive oil directly in the air fryer basket?
Yes, it’s safe to spray olive oil directly in the air fryer basket, but avoid aerosol sprays with propellants that can damage the non-stick coating. Use propellant-free olive oil sprays or apply liquid oil with a brush to protect your air fryer and ensure even cooking.
